Sines

Sines is a small habour city that is very untouristic,  meaning that there are very few tourist coming there, most of them coming here are travellars by car or native tourists. The old city is very nice and with its white houses is a pleasant stay.  We went in to the city almost every day when we where finished at the beach.

There are good supermarkets with wonderful fruit and vegetables as you find it all over Portugal and we had the fortune to find a very nice restaurant down at the habour where we went and had over diner a couple of times.
